Eshowe
Eshowe is a small town in Zululand with a long history. It is the oldest town of European settlement in the Zululand region. Its name is thought to have been inspired by the sound of wind blowing through the forest by which it is surrounded. It became King Cetshwayo’s headquarters when he built a kraal at the site in 1860.
